深入了解lgalertview:GitHub上的优质弹窗组件

在现代应用程序开发中,用户体验至关重要。尤其是在移动应用和网页应用中,弹窗(Alert)是常用的用户交互方式之一。lgalertview是一个优秀的弹窗组件,提供了丰富的功能和灵活的使用方式。本文将详细介绍lgalertview在GitHub上的相关信息,包括安装、使用方法、功能特性以及常见问题解答。

目录

  1. 什么是lgalertview
  2. lgalertview的主要功能
  3. 安装lgalertview
  4. 使用lgalertview
  5. lgalertview的配置选项
  6. 常见问题解答

什么是lgalertview

lgalertview是一个开源的弹窗组件,专为简化用户通知和交互而设计。该组件以简单易用著称,适合于多种开发环境。lgalertview能够在应用程序中快速生成美观的弹窗,以便与用户进行有效的沟通。

lgalertview的主要功能

  • 自定义样式:用户可以根据需求自由定制弹窗的样式和外观。
  • 多种类型的弹窗:支持信息、警告、确认等多种类型的弹窗。
  • 回调功能:支持在用户与弹窗互动时进行回调处理。
  • 支持多种平台:可在Web和移动端均可使用,保证跨平台兼容性。

安装lgalertview

通过GitHub下载

用户可以通过以下步骤从GitHub上下载并安装lgalertview

  1. 访问GitHub上的lgalertview页面
  2. 点击“Clone or download”按钮,选择下载方式(ZIP或Git命令)。
  3. 将下载的文件解压并放入您的项目目录中。

使用包管理器

若您使用Node.js,可以通过npm安装: bash npm install lgalertview

使用lgalertview

创建基本弹窗

javascript import { AlertView } from ‘lgalertview’;

AlertView.show({ title: ‘标题’, message: ‘这是弹窗内容’, buttonText: ‘确认’, onPress: () => { console.log(‘弹窗已关闭’); } });

添加多个按钮

您还可以添加多个按钮来处理不同的用户选择: javascript AlertView.show({ title: ‘选择操作’, message: ‘请选择一个选项’, buttons: [ { text: ‘选项1’, onPress: () => console.log(‘选择了选项1’) }, { text: ‘选项2’, onPress: () => console.log(‘选择了选项2’) } ] });

lgalertview的配置选项

用户可以通过以下配置选项来优化弹窗的使用体验:

  • title:弹窗标题
  • message:弹窗内容
  • buttonText:按钮文字(单按钮时使用)
  • buttons:按钮数组(支持多个按钮)
  • onPress:按钮回调函数
  • style:自定义弹窗样式

常见问题解答

1. lgalertview是否支持自定义样式?

是的,lgalertview允许用户通过设置style属性来自定义弹窗的样式。您可以修改颜色、字体、边框等样式,以使弹窗符合应用的整体风格。

2. lgalertview的兼容性如何?

lgalertview兼容主流浏览器及移动设备,确保能够在多种平台上流畅运行。用户可以在不同的设备上体验一致的弹窗效果。

3. 如何在弹窗中添加图标?

您可以通过修改弹窗的内容来实现,例如在message中插入图标的HTML代码,或者使用支持图标的按钮。

4. 如何处理弹窗的关闭事件?

可以在按钮的onPress回调函数中处理弹窗关闭后的逻辑。您可以在这里进行相关操作,比如更新UI或发起网络请求。

5. lgalertview的支持社区如何?

lgalertview在GitHub上拥有活跃的社区,用户可以通过提问、反馈和贡献代码来参与项目。官方文档及示例也提供了丰富的资源供开发者参考。

结论

lgalertview是一个功能强大且灵活的弹窗组件,适用于多种开发场景。通过本文的介绍,希望您对lgalertview有了全面的了解,并能够在项目中灵活使用。有关该项目的更多信息和最新更新,请访问GitHub页面

正文完